- Black Paddy (Fabu-D) is one of Ireland’s most recognisable online personalities, a comedian, storyteller and content creator known for travelling through towns across the island, meeting people, sharing laughs and bringing his own energy everywhere he goes.
He shares the story behind Black Paddy, coming to Ireland from Nigeria, building a life here, and becoming a bridge between cultures. He opens up about Irish humour, racism, social media, fatherhood, faith, comedy and the personal battles that shaped the man behind the viral videos.
A funny, honest and powerful conversation about identity, culture, resilience, second chances and why what you give out comes back to you.

13/07/2026 | 1h 4 mins.Karen O’Leary is one of Ireland’s best known family and child law solicitors, senior partner and head of family and child law at Caldwell & Robinson Solicitors.
Karen shares clear, practical advice on divorce, separation, prenups, cohabitation rights and family law in Ireland. She explains the myth of common law marriage, what happens to the family home, pensions, businesses and finances when a relationship breaks down, and why living together does not give you the same legal protection as marriage.
Karen also talks about mediation, protecting your privacy during separation, supporting children through divorce, and why uploading private family law or divorce documents to ChatGPT could get you into serious trouble.
A must listen for anyone going through separation, thinking about divorce, living with a partner, or wanting to understand their legal rights before they need them.

06/07/2026 | 59 mins.Stephen McCammon is the Managing Director and owner of Menarys, the historic department store chain with a story that goes back over 103 years.
Stephen shares the story behind Menarys, from its beginnings in Dungannon in 1923 to becoming one of Northern Ireland’s most recognised family retail businesses, now with 25 stores in 2026.
He talks about the ring that reminds him where it all began, growing up during the Troubles, surviving bomb damage, the credit crunch, Covid, and the collapse of Arcadia.
Stephen also opens up about leadership, succession, rebuilding after setbacks, and why Menarys still believes in the high street, community, and the people on the shop floor.
This is a powerful conversation about family business, retail resilience, and what it really takes to keep going when everything around you is changing.

29/06/2026 | 57 mins.Marie Boyle works in Snaubs Boutique in Newry, but behind her warmth, humour and positivity is a story of unimaginable loss. At just 21 years old, Marie lost both of her parents and her sister in one night.
Marie shares what happened, how she found a way to keep going, and the tools that helped her live through grief, including talking, meditation, EFT tapping, energy healing, signs, faith and learning how to be kind to herself on the hardest days.
This is a powerful conversation about grief, trauma, loss, resilience, healing and learning how to live again after the worst thing imaginable. Marie speaks so openly about the pain of losing her family, the guilt that can come with feeling joy again, and the small moments of grace that helped her rebuild her life.
It is heartbreaking, but it is also full of light. A reminder that even in the darkest moments, there can still be hope.

22/06/2026 | 55 mins.Father Conor McGrath is a Catholic priest, vocations director and one of the youngest men to become a parish priest in Ireland.
Father Conor talks about being called to priesthood from a young age, becoming ordained at 25, and what life as a priest is really like today.
Faith, loneliness, people walking away from the Catholic Church, social media, women in the Church, leadership, parish life, different cultures coming together, and why asking questions about religion matters were all discussed.
Whether you are a person of faith, have stepped away from the Church, or are simply curious about priesthood and modern religion in Ireland, this is an honest conversation about faith, community and belonging.
